Welcome to Englewood ...

Englewood is located in Oconee County<1>.


The location of Englewood has been provided by the Geographic Names Information System (ie- the GNIS).<2>


When the people of Englewood refer to themselves (known as a demonym), they frequently use Englewoodite<3>

Englewood is 870 feet [265 m] above sea level.<4>.

Time Zone: Englewood lies in the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T) and observes daylight saving time

Telephone area codes for Englewood: (470)<5>, (678) and (770).

Using our Gazetteer, we found that there are two Georgia communities named Englewood: This one is located in Oconee County and the other is located in Muscogee County.

Beyond Georgia, there are 36 communities that are also named Englewood - they are located in Alabama, British Columbia, California, Colorado, Florida (3), Illinois, Indiana, Kansas, Louisiana (2), Maryland, Massachusetts, Missouri (2), New Jersey, New York, North Carolina (3), Ohio, Oregon (2), Pennsylvania (2), Saskatchewan, South Carolina, South Dakota, Tennessee (3), Texas, Virginia and Wisconsin.
